Per LSUSports.net: COLUMBIA, Mo. — Eighth-ranked LSU pushed across a run in the top of the 10th inning to post a 12-11 win over Missouri at Taylor Stadium.
In the top of the 10th, shortstop Josh Smith singled with one out and went to third on centerfielder Giovanni DiGiacomo’s single. When rightfielder Antoine Duplantis grounded to third, Missouri’s Austin James threw home, but Smith slid around catcher Chad McDaniel’s tag.
